Senior Software Architect
1 week ago
Job ID
Date posted Nov. 07, 2025
Location Cambridge, United Kingdom
Category Hardware Engineering
Overview
The Central Technology Team within Arm develops key technologies which will form the foundation of future products. You will join a multinational, dynamic, collaborative and highly motivated Graphics team in Central Technology to help craft the direction of our world leading Mali Graphics products. The Mali Graphics Processor is the #1 shipping GPU.
You will need to have architecture and software development skills, in addition to being able to think creatively. In this role you can expect to be a technical lead where your ideas will make a difference and enable you to make your mark delivering industry leading GPU IP.
Your job responsibilities will be diverse and may include architecture, technology research, hands-on prototyping and experimental investigations, participating in key industry consortium's, engaging with product groups, working closely together with the engineering team, and taking part in partner and customer engagements.
Responsibilities:
This exciting position, will offer you the opportunity to work on the newest technology in a collaborative environment to:
- Design and develop the Mali graphics architecture for the latest graphics APIs, providing new technologies for products in new and existing markets
- Ensure the Mali graphics architecture is ready for the next generation of developers to optimise on.
- Drive the Mali graphics architecture to meet future content demands.
- Perform high level performance modelling and analysis of graphics hardware features, applications, benchmarks and games.
- Develop and improve tools for architectural exploration and performance analysis.
- Understand and analyse system level architectural trade-offs (including hardware, memory systems and system s/w).
- Collaborate with the Arm engineering team to see your ideas delivered into products.
Required Skills and Experience:
- BSEE or BSCS required. MS/PhD in EE or CS preferred.
- Minimum 15+ years Computer Graphics experiences or equivalent required.
- A strong history of thinking creatively and communicating effectively in a global team environment, with a practical, organized and analytical approach to work.
- A deep experience and background in Computer Graphics and GPU architecture
- You have an ability to quantify and make trade-offs between power, performance and area appropriately to meet the requirements of the product.
- You have a strong programming ability: C, C++, scripting.
- Good knowledge of graphics and computer API's (OpenGL, OpenCL, DX, etc.).
- Excellent team working skills, self-motivated and results focused.
"Nice to Haves" Skills and Experience:
- A repeated experience of driving architecture development with the focus on performance, power, area and bandwidth (PPAB) optimizations.
- Your previous experience may have involved performance modeling micro-architecture
- Your previous roles may have included experience of RTL design for GPU's.
In Return:
You will develop the roadmap for Arm's core interconnect and control subsystems, ensuring they are strategically aligned and technically validated across markets. While the initial focus is infrastructure, you will work across line of business and customers to ensure these foundational technologies are robust, driven, and reusable across Arm's diverse product portfolio. Your ownership of requirement specs and roadmap rigor will ensure subsystem coherence across product generations — enabling Arm to scale from IP to complete system solutions.
Our 10x mindset guides how we engineer, collaborate, and grow. Understand what it means and how to reflect 10x in your work:
Apply for this opportunity
Share on your newsfeed
Didn't find what you were looking for?
Join our talent community. Click here to get started.
Accommodations at Arm
At Arm, we want our people to Do Great Things. If you need support or an accommodation to Be Your Brilliant Self during the recruitment process, please email To note, by sending us the requested information, you consent to its use by Arm to arrange for appropriate accommodations. All accommodation requests will be treated with confidentiality, and information concerning these requests will only be disclosed as necessary to provide the accommodation. Although this is not an exhaustive list, examples of support include breaks between interviews, having documents read aloud or office accessibility. Please email us about anything we can do to accommodate you during the recruitment process.
Equal Opportunities at Arm
Arm is an equal opportunity employer, committed to providing an environment of mutual respect where equal opportunities are available to all applicants and colleagues. We are a diverse organization of dedicated and innovative individuals, and don't discriminate on the basis of race, color, religion, sex, sexual orientation, gender identity, national origin, disability, or status as a protected veteran.
Hybrid Working at Arm
Arm's hybrid approach to working is centred around flexibility, where we split our time between the office and other locations to get our work done. Within that framework, we empower groups and teams to determine their own particular hybrid working pattern, depending on the work and the team's needs. Details of what this means for each role will be shared upon application. In some cases, the flexibility we can offer is limited by local legal, regulatory, tax, or other considerations, and where this is the case, we will collaborate with you to find the best solution. Please talk to us to find out more about what this could look like for you.
Accommodations at Arm
At Arm, we want to build extraordinary teams. If you need an adjustment or an accommodation during the recruitment process, please email To note, by sending us the requested information, you consent to its use by Arm to arrange for appropriate accommodations. All accommodation or adjustment requests will be treated with confidentiality, and information concerning these requests will only be disclosed as necessary to provide the accommodation. Although this is not an exhaustive list, examples of support include breaks between interviews, having documents read aloud, or office accessibility. Please email us about anything we can do to accommodate you during the recruitment process.
Hybrid Working at Arm
Arm's approach to hybrid working is designed to create a working environment that supports both high performance and personal wellbeing. We believe in bringing people together face to face to enable us to work at pace, whilst recognizing the value of flexibility. Within that framework, we empower groups/teams to determine their own hybrid working patterns, depending on the work and the team's needs. Details of what this means for each role will be shared upon application. In some cases, the flexibility we can offer is limited by local legal, regulatory, tax, or other considerations, and where this is the case, we will collaborate with you to find the best solution. Please talk to us to find out more about what this could look like for you.
Equal Opportunities at Arm
Arm is an equal opportunity employer, committed to providing an environment of mutual respect where equal opportunities are available to all applicants and colleagues. We are a diverse organization of dedicated and innovative individuals, and don't discriminate on the basis of race, color, religion, sex, sexual orientation, gender identity, national origin, disability, or status as a protected veteran.
-
System Software Architect
2 weeks ago
Cambridge, Cambridgeshire, United Kingdom IC Resources Full time £90,000 - £120,000 per yearI'm partnering with one of the UK's most respected independent technology consultancies – a place where engineers, scientists, and inventors come together to solve problems that matter.Think connected medical implants, next-gen satellite systems, low-latency automation, advanced imaging, and AI-driven platforms – no two projects are ever the same. It's...
-
Senior GPU Software Architect
2 weeks ago
Cambridge, Cambridgeshire, United Kingdom Huawei Technologies Research & Development (UK) Ltd Full time £150,000 - £250,000 per yearAbout Huawei Research And Development UK LimitedFounded in 1987, Huawei is a leading global provider of information and communications technology (ICT) infrastructure and smart devices. We have 207,000 employees and operate in over 170 countries and regions, serving more than three billion people around the world.Our vision and mission is to bring digital to...
-
Systems Software Architect
6 days ago
Cambridge, Cambridgeshire, United Kingdom TTP Full time £60,000 - £120,000 per yearJob Description TTP's central software capability has become a core part of how we deliver innovative, impactful solutions across a wide range of industries. From connected medical implants and desktop biology tools, to safety-critical systems, next-generation satellite communications, low-latency industrial automation, advanced imaging, and large-scale IoT...
-
Senior Software Engineer
2 weeks ago
Cambridge, Cambridgeshire, United Kingdom TTP Full time £60,000 - £100,000 per yearCompany Description Cell therapies have been shown to cure devastating and previously untreatable diseases like cancer by re-programming the patient's own immune system. Giving more patients access to these life-saving therapies requires a revolution in manufacturing and process automation. Cellular Origins, a TTP Company, is enabling scalable,...
-
Chief Product Architect
2 weeks ago
Cambridge, Cambridgeshire, United Kingdom The ONE Group Ltd Full time £80,000 - £120,000 per yearRole:Chief Product ArchitectSalary: Depending on ExperienceLocation:Cambridgeshire, on-siteWith a strong focus on mission critical communications, this is a unique opportunity to shape the technical vision of an innovative product suite that powers the future of secure, connected communication systems. You'll be responsible for driving the architecture,...
-
Senior Product Manager
2 weeks ago
Cambridge, Cambridgeshire, United Kingdom Redgate Software Full time £70,000 - £90,000 per yearRedgate SoftwareRedgate creates simple software to help data professionals get the most value out of any database. Our solutions solve complex database management challenges across the DevOps lifecycle, making life easier for IT leaders, development, and operations teams by increasing efficiency, reducing errors, and protecting business-critical data. The...
-
Senior Software Technology Manager
12 hours ago
Cambridge, Cambridgeshire, United Kingdom Arm Full time £80,000 - £120,000 per yearAs a Senior Software Technology Manager, you will work with Arm's key customers to define and prioritise requirements for software enablement and optimization and to develop strategies to deliver them working within Arm and our software ecosystem.Our Central Engineering Software group has a bridging role across Arm's technologies. You will be part of our...
-
Senior Staff System Software Engineer
5 days ago
Cambridge, Cambridgeshire, United Kingdom Graphcore Full time £60,000 - £120,000 per yearAbout GraphcoreGraphcore is one of the world's leading innovators in Artificial Intelligence compute.It is developing hardware, software and systems infrastructure that will unlock the next generation of AI breakthroughs and power the widespread adoption of AI solutions across every industry.As part of the SoftBank Group, Graphcore is a member of an elite...
-
Senior Staff System Software Engineer
5 days ago
Cambridge, Cambridgeshire, United Kingdom Graphcore Full time £60,000 - £120,000 per yearAbout GraphcoreGraphcore is one of the world's leading innovators in Artificial Intelligence compute. It is developing hardware, software and systems infrastructure that will unlock the next generation of AI breakthroughs and power the widespread adoption of AI solutions across every industry. As part of the SoftBank Group, Graphcore is a member...
-
Software Development Manager,
6 days ago
Cambridge, Cambridgeshire, United Kingdom Ring Full time £80,000 - £120,000 per yearDescriptionRing is looking for a Software Development Manager responsible for leading a team of engineers working on the development and production of products, focusing on safety and security based connected products, including sensors, networking back-up systems, connected accessories for security cameras, doorbells, and outdoor floodlight cameras. This...